Summary of Responsibilities:
- Act as the primary point of contact for investigative sites during the start‑up phase
- Conduct site outreach, feasibility and perform remote Pre-Study Visits
- Perform country Participant Information Sheets/Informed Consent Forms adaptation to French requirements
- Manage country and site level documents for Part II submission under EU CTR and perform submissions to Ethics Committees, Third Bodies and Regulatory Authorities as applicable
- Perform site contracts and budget negotiations
- Coordinate and track essential regulatory documents to ensure timely and compliant site activation and maintenance of site regulatory compliance throughout the study
- Support the CRA team in preparing for Site Initiation Visits to ensure timely distribution of clinical study supplies, accesses, and documents
- Perform remote visits as required by the monitoring plan
- Perform Case Review Form (CRF) review and monitoring of site protocol deviations and Serious Adverse Event (SAE) reporting
- Actively participate in study team meetings to support study progress, develop and implement action plans for site level risks, underperforming sites, or issues impacting project milestones and escalate issues in a timely manner
- Maintain accurate documentation in study systems and ensure the TMF is inspection‑ready
